SHUBMAN GILL

After his outstanding performance in the Asia Cup 2023, Shubman Gill has closed the distance on Babar at the top of the ICC ODI Rankings for batsmen. This year, Gill has scored over 1000 runs in ODIs.

After the latest update on September 20, Wednesday, India’s new batting star Shubman Gill has reduced the gap on Babar Azam at the top of the ICC ODI Rankings for hitters.

Gill has had an outstanding ODI season in 2023. His performance in the Asia Cup 2023 was especially significant, as he finished as the top run-getter. In India’s final Super 4 game, he struck his fifth ODI century against Bangladesh, adding to his two fifties in the competition. This achievement was an important milestone in Gill’s career, as he became the 13th Indian to score 1000 runs in ODIs in the calendar year 2023.

Gill’s ODI consistency has been outstanding since he began opening the batting in ODIs in December 2020. His performance in 2023, on the other hand, was outstanding. In 17 innings this year, he drove in 1,025 runs with a 68.33 ERA and a strikeout rate of 103.32.

In addition to his 1000 runs in ODIs for the calendar year, Gill also reached 1500 runs across formats this year, with six hundreds and five fifties in 33 outings. His performance at the Asia Cup 2023 was critical to him reaching these goals. Despite a modest decline in form during the West Indies trip in July, which lasted into the Asia Cup, Gill silenced detractors with his outstanding performance.

With this, the 24-year-old has scored the most runs for India this year across all formats, and he is the only Indian hitter to have scored hundreds in all three formats of the game. Gill presently trails Babar by just 43 rating points in the latest update of the ICC ODI Rankings.

Before the Asia Cup, the Indian batter had begun to close the distance on Pakistan’s captain and now has a chance to pass him if he has a great series against Australia.
